I use Meguiar's Quik Interior Detailer. It is non-glossy and nearly odor free. I use it on all of the interior vinyl, plastics, NAV screen and as a weekly maintenance on the leather. It does leave UV protection behind.

Some popular choices are:
303 Aerospace Protectant for a darker, slightly glossy finish.
-or-
Einszett 1Z Cockpit Premium or Optimum Protectant Plus for a nice, matte, factory look.
All 3 protect from UV rays and are safe to use on your interior components.

My feeling is that 303 is a great protector but it has two very disturbing problems for me. The first is the odor and the second is the level of gloss. I want zero gloss on my dash and 303 leaves it slightly shiny causing glare at sunrise and sunset. The odor is too strong for my liking but it dissipates after a day or two. Yet it the gloss that I mainly object to.
